The Importance of Jaw Crushers in Gold Mining
Primary Crushing Stage: Jaw crushers are typically used in the primary crushing stage of gold mining. They are designed to handle the initial breaking down of ore from the mine, which can be in large, irregular chunks. This is a crucial step as it significantly reduces the size of the ore, making it easier to process further down the line.
Efficiency and Productivity: The use of jaw crushers in gold mining enhances efficiency and productivity. By breaking down ore into smaller pieces, these machines enable smoother operation of milling and grinding equipment. This ensures that the extraction process is continuous and that downtime is minimized.

How Jaw Crushers Work in Gold Mining
Jaw crushers operate by using compressive force to break down materials. The material is fed into the crusher’s chamber, where a fixed and a moving jaw plate create a V-shaped cavity. As the moving jaw plate moves back and forth against the fixed jaw plate, the material is crushed into smaller pieces. This simple yet effective mechanism is ideal for the demands of gold mining.
High Reduction Ratio: One of the significant advantages of jaw crushers is their high reduction ratio. They can process large volumes of hard and abrasive materials, reducing them to smaller sizes in a single pass. This is particularly beneficial in gold mining, where the ore can be exceptionally hard and abrasive.
Robust Construction: Jaw crushers are built to withstand the harsh conditions of mining environments. They are constructed from heavy-duty materials that can handle the wear and tear associated with crushing hard ores. This durability ensures a long service life and reliable operation, which is essential in gold mining where machinery uptime is critical.
Benefits of Using Jaw Crushers in Gold Mining
Cost-Effectiveness: Jaw crushers are a cost-effective solution for primary crushing in gold mining. Their straightforward design and low maintenance requirements make them an economical choice for mining operations looking to maximize their return on investment.
Versatility: These crushers are highly versatile and can be used in various stages of the mining process. They are not only used for primary crushing but can also be adapted for secondary and tertiary crushing if needed. This flexibility makes them invaluable in a mining operation.
Enhanced Recovery Rates: By efficiently reducing the size of the ore, jaw crushers contribute to higher recovery rates in gold extraction processes. Smaller ore particles increase the surface area exposed to extraction chemicals, leading to more efficient gold recovery.
Considerations for Selecting Jaw Crushers
When choosing a jaw crusher for a gold mining operation, several factors must be considered to ensure optimal performance and longevity:
Feed Size and Output Requirements: It’s crucial to select a jaw crusher that can handle the feed size of the raw material and produce the desired output size. The capacity of the crusher should match the requirements of the mining operation to maintain efficiency.
Material Hardness and Abrasiveness: The hardness and abrasiveness of the ore should dictate the type of jaw crusher used. Heavy-duty jaw crushers with robust construction are ideal for hard and abrasive materials typically found in gold mines.
Maintenance and Spare Parts Availability: Reliable operation of a jaw crusher depends on regular maintenance and the availability of spare parts. Choosing a crusher from a reputable manufacturer with a good support network ensures that any downtime is minimized.
